Eris, goddess of discord, railing about with her lunar companion, Dysnomia, goddess of lawlessness, might seem a bit scary. No wonder astrologers shun her. How can something positive be made from her stories? She single-handedly started the Trojan War as the event line tracked by rolling an apple bearing the inscription “for the fairest” to the feet of the power goddesses, Athena, Aphrodite and Hera who attended the wedding of Peleus and Thetis - a wedding from which she had been snubbed. Jupiter, lord of the gods, appreciated the tricky skill set of Eris. When Jupiter decided he did not favor the rulership outcome in the land of Mycenae, he dispatched Mercury to ask the ruler (the guy Jupiter did not like, or at least he favored the other contender more), Thyestes, that if the Sun rose in the west, would he relinquish his rulership to Atreus, who briefed ruled before Thyestes bull dogged his way in by accusing of Atreus of lying and boasting. While we might assume the odds of that celestial oddity to be astronomical, one might also wonder why the trickster Mercury bore the message. When Mercury delivers, accept the telegram with caution and pay attention. Regardless, Thyestes agreed. Jupiter dispatched Eris, asking that she bring her discordance attributes, and together, for one day, they reversed the order of the heavens. The Sun and Moon rose in the west, the stars reversed their directions and the Pleiades wept.
